For those not updating their CPU to 5000 series this BIOS fixes issues with getting boost clocks on 3000 series cpus. My 3700X which is a crappy first run edition is now hitting:
Core0-4.425ghz
Core1-4.400ghz
Core2-4.400ghz
Core3-4.425ghz
Core4-4.375ghz
Core5-4.425ghz
Core6-4.375ghz
Core7-4.400ghz
All cores stay at 4.375ghz or higher when gaming.
I havent messed with PBO setting or OCing as of yet.
